Transaction 231be2649ca32c0cc250f8d4da0c654a01211c8204f17ca286f3557caf01c1f7
1 Input
1 Output
-
231be2649ca32c0cc250f8d4da0c654a01211c8204f17ca286f3557caf01c1f7:0
- value
- 11549876
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f3d8645140c23dd340e7880ed20666b28bf94ea
- address
- bc1qhu7cv3g5ps3a6dqw0zqw6grxdv5tl982fvfj2t